Job description

SUMMARY:

Ensures the company\'s software products meet quality standards by researching, consulting, performing testing processes and leveraging automation tools to measure total product quality. Performs quality assurance activities requiring planning, scheduling, and testing to ensure that developed or third-party products meet functional business requirements and technical design specifications.

JOB D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ES:
  • Manage QA department.
  • Manage QA team resources as direct reports.
  • Setup processes to improve team efficiency, productivity, and product quality.
  • Ensures process adherence.
  • Review testing strategies to make sure deliverables are tested from different angles like performance, scalability, and usability.
  • Meet with Product Manager and Dev Manager to choose sprint scope based on QA resource availability and Product Management\'s work item priorities.
  • Coordinate with Dev Manager and DevOps on the timing of QA release deployments.
  • Manage QA team\'s execution against the sprint plan.
  • Responsible for QA deliverables and status reporting.
  • Lead the QA project team and help the team get to the project completion.
  • Review the test scenarios and test strategies to ensure top quality application delivery.
  • Communicate the project QA status to higher authorities.
  • Responsible for maintaining QA artifacts.
  • Ensures test cases are developed based upon business requirements and technical design specifications with emphasis on positive testing, negative testing, integration testing, and performance/ stress testing.
  • Develops and executes automation testing strategy and processes.
  • Responsible for test environment setup including application installation, test data preparation, documentation, and assets management.
  • Provides feedback loop to Product Manager and Development Mangers on overall product quality.
  • Peer-Review test scripts and test results.
  • Contributes to the success of the organization by helping others accomplish job results; learning new skills needed by the team; finding new ways to help the team.
WORK EXPERIENCE AND EDUCATION REQUIREMENTS:
  • Bachelor\'s degree from a four-year College or university and at least three to five years related experience and/or training; or equivalent combination of education and experience.
  • 6+ years Quality Assurance experience.
  • 2+ years of experience with automated test tools Such as Selenium, Python, or Cucumber
  • 2+ years of experience working on SAAS products
  • A good understanding of SQL - able to create SQL scripts to obtain required data.
  • Excellent communication skills.
  • Leadership and conflict resolution skills.
  • Critical thinking and multitasking.
  • General programming knowledge and experience.
  • Ability to develop detailed test cases based on software/hardware changes.
  • Ability to execute and evaluate results of detailed test cases.
  • Ability to learn new technologies and business concepts quickly.
  • Knowledge of the system/software development life cycle.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ills.
  • Experience with automated test tools is required.
  • Familiarity with the Agile Development process is a plus.
  • QA certification is a plus.
